Can anyone tell me what app I can place on a phone in order to only allow access to specific websites I list?

Most software I am looking at lets you block specific sites or categories of sites, but there are way to many for that to ever work 100%.

You are wanting to have a whitelist of allowed sites... Only thing I know of would be an enterprise level device management suite, any app you download is going to be removable by the user, they can simply turn it off or uninstall it. So you would have to lock down the phone/tablet. I am sure there are apps that claim to do it, but my guess is that any that do not cost at least 3 or 4 figures (server cost plus client license) are going to do a horrible job at it. And really if you are only looking at doing it for one device, there may not be a solution.
